In this episode of the Being Human podcast I sat down with Dr Hussain Al-Zubaidi (@irondoctorhaz). Over the past 3 months @mrashleycain has ran the length of the UK, cycled the length of the UK, and kayaked the length of the UK. He has been completing this challenge to raise money for @theazayliafoundation - the charity he founded in honour and memory of his daughter Azaylia, to fight against childhood cancer. He will officially be finishing ‘ULTRAMAN’ at John O’Groats this weekend, Saturday 20th July. When he does, he will be the first man in history to ever do so. Dr Haz has been Ashley’s coach for ULTRAMAN. He devised the training programme and structure of the challenge, that has enabled Ashley to be able to complete this monumental feat. In this conversation we dived deep into Ashley’s training, the challenge itself, and everything behind it from Haz’s end. Haz shared: - What he initially thought Ashley’s chances of success were for completing the challenge. - The training programme Ashley underwent in the months leading up to the challenge. - What has happened to Ashley’s body over the past 3 months during ULTRAMAN that has enabled him to continue on to complete it. - How to fuel yourself for endurance challenges to optimise performance and prevent injuries.
